Meaning of "Watch Me Bleed" by Scary Kids Scaring Kids


The lyrics of "Watch Me Bleed" convey a sense of despair and helplessness in a toxic relationship. The narrator is stuck in a situation where they have given their all, but their partner has taken advantage of their vulnerability, leaving them feeling empty and unfulfilled. The silence mentioned in the opening lines represents the facade or the lack of communication within the relationship. It creates an illusion of safety, but as the relationship deteriorates, the narrator's pain becomes louder and more evident. The line "All you needed was time, but now time will destroy us" suggests that time has become an enemy in the relationship, as it only exacerbates the damage and brings them closer to the end.

The repeated phrase "Watch me bleed" takes on different meanings throughout the song. Initially, it signifies the partner's passive observation of the narrator's suffering. It implies that the partner is aware of the pain they are causing but does nothing to alleviate it. Additionally, the line "You watch me bleed" can also be interpreted as the partner deriving some satisfaction or power from seeing the narrator in pain. It symbolizes the emotional manipulation and cruelty inflicted by the partner, causing the narrator to feel like they are slowly fading away, losing their colors and vitality.

The line "I gave you everything to die with a smile" reveals the narrator's willingness to sacrifice everything for the relationship. They wanted their partner to be happy, even if it meant their own suffering. However, the partner's actions left them feeling empty and unfulfilled. The salted earth mentioned throughout the song represents a barren and toxic emotional landscape where nothing can grow or flourish. This reinforces the sense of despair and hopelessness in the relationship.

Overall, "Watch Me Bleed" captures the painful dynamics of a toxic relationship where one person gives their all while the other takes advantage and remains indifferent to the suffering they cause. It explores themes of emotional manipulation, sacrifice, and the destructive nature of toxic love.
